Output 53788722921305b31a8f3ef62c5c02173abc535c3169d537a80512f0993c508d:2

value
1454055393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d858d96b94c1095a05da757428870afa0ea0318 OP_EQUAL
address
MAbFpRYg5DzqqTyXSMQsNHxB2PGkg21tCJ
transaction
53788722921305b31a8f3ef62c5c02173abc535c3169d537a80512f0993c508d
spent
true